🔹What is fermentation, and why is it a breakthrough in cosmetology?🔹

Fermentation is a biochemical process in which microorganisms such as bacteria and yeast transform organic ingredients into compounds with higher bioavailability. In cosmetics, this allows for the extraction of active substances with increased effectiveness that are better tolerated by the skin and deliver more intensive effects.

🔹Benefits of fermentation in cosmetics🔹

Enhanced absorption of active ingredients
Fermentation breaks down large molecules into smaller ones, allowing them to penetrate deeper into the skin and deliver nutrients exactly where they are needed.

Strengthening the skin’s natural protective barrier
Fermented ingredients support the skin microbiome, helping maintain its balance and protecting it from harmful external factors.

Gentleness and reduced irritation
The fermentation process eliminates potentially irritating substances, making fermented cosmetics safe even for sensitive skin.

Natural anti-aging effects
Fermented extracts are rich in antioxidants, amino acids, and peptides, which improve skin elasticity and reduce signs of aging.

Sustainable production and eco-friendliness
Fermented cosmetics utilize natural biological processes, reducing the need for synthetic chemicals and supporting eco-friendly trends.

🔹How does fermentation work in cosmetics?🔹

The fermentation process requires precise control of temperature, pH, and duration to achieve the highest quality active ingredients. After fermentation, raw materials are purified and stabilized to ensure their effectiveness and safety in cosmetics.

Technological challenges and standardization

The production of fermented cosmetics requires advanced technology and precise quality control to ensure stability and consistency. Key aspects include:

Maintaining production stability – Controlling the fermentation process to achieve uniform ingredient properties.
Specific storage requirements – Some fermented ingredients require special preservation conditions.
Legal regulations – Compliance with safety and efficacy standards.
